(St. George, UT) — Parts of southern Utah are under an Excessive Heat Warning from noon today through 9 p.m. Saturday with temperatures expected between 102 and 108 degrees. That warning is for Washington, Garfield, and Kane counties along with the Lake Powell area, while lower Washington County and south central Utah are under an excessive heat watch tomorrow afternoon. St. George and Lake Powell could hit 110 degrees, while Cedar City will be much cooler, with highs in the low 90s.
